Gas Certificates

What is required of the landlord?

It is the duty of a landlord when renting a property to ensure that your property has a valid Gas Safety Certificate in line with the Gas Safety (Installation and USE) Regulations 1998 for all pipe work, flues and appliances. What is the Gas Safe Register?

The Gas Safe register is the replacement for CORGI which came into place on the 1st April 2009 in Great Britain and the Isle of Man.

What is a Gas Safe Engineer?

A Gas Safe engineer is an engineer who has been verified as being capable and qualified to work with gas legally and safely. They will be able to prove they are a gas safe register with their Gas Safe ID Number.

Do I need to provide Carbon Monoxide Alarms?

The Health & Safety Executive recommend the utilization of Carbon Monoxide Alarms as an early warning system for tenants. A CO alarm can be purchased for £20-£30. When purchasing a CO alarm you should check for the British Standard EN 50291 and a British or European approval mark, for instance the Kitemark. The use of CO alarms should not be seen as an alternative to a Gas Safety certificate.
